Griffins Earn Six RMAC Academic Honors

SALT LAKE CITY — Westminster Volleyball continued its strong tradition of academic excellence as six Griffins were recognized by the Rocky Mountain Athletic Conference for their work in the classroom, highlighted by two First Team All-Academic selections.

Senior setter Leila Cornejo (Elementary Education, 3.89 GPA) and senior middle blocker Hailey Killett (Business Marketing, 3.98 GPA) earned spots on the 2025 RMAC First Team Academic All-Conference, placing them among the league's top student-athletes for academic achievement and on-court performance.

Four additional Griffins earned spots on the RMAC Academic Honor Roll:

The honors reflect Westminster's continued commitment to academic success across the volleyball program.
